Waiuku Central Rental Yield 2026

Waiuku Central is a small, established township community on Auckland's southern Manukau Harbour coastline, attracting a stable mix of families and working households. With a median weekly rent of $510 and indicative gross yields ranging from 2.3% to 3%, the suburb offers modest but consistent rental income for patient investors.

Investing in Waiuku Central

Who Rents in Waiuku Central?

Renters make up 36% of households in Waiuku Central, reflecting a township where owner-occupiers remain the majority but a meaningful tenant pool exists. With a median age of 37 and a median household income of $90,500, the local renting demographic skews towards working families and couples seeking a quieter lifestyle within reach of broader Auckland employment corridors.

The suburb's compact population of 1,344 means the rental market is relatively tight, which can support consistent occupancy when well-priced properties are listed. Rents across the lower to upper quartile range from $434 to $575 per week, giving investors a reasonable sense of what different property configurations are likely to achieve.

Yield & Cash-Flow Considerations

Indicative gross yields in Waiuku Central sit between 2.3% and 3%, calculated against the Auckland median price of $1,000,000. These yields are at the lower end of what many investors seek, so careful attention to purchase price relative to achievable rent is essential to make the numbers work.

Investors should factor in the suburb's relatively small rental pool and distance from major Auckland employment hubs, which can affect both vacancy periods and rental growth momentum. Running a full cash-flow analysis — accounting for rates, insurance, maintenance, and property management fees — is strongly recommended before committing.
